PHP PARSE ERROR: UNEXPECTED '<' IN ... EVAL () 'CÓDIGO D ON L

O PHP pode encontrar erros de análise . Esses erros de análise ocorrem devido à entrada incorreta da sintaxe. Esse tipo de erro de sintaxe pode ocorrer durante o uso da função eval () também. Esse erro ocorre com mais freqüência devido à presença do PHP em torno das strings do PHP que devem ser avaliadas. As tags de abertura criam os erros e, uma vez removidos, o problema é resolvido. As tags de fechamento podem ser usadas para sair do modelo. Insights sobre o webmaster definitivamente ajudarão a resolver os problemas de erros de análise do PHP.

Questão

Ao usar a função eval () no PHP, a seguinte mensagem é exibida:

 Erro de análise do PHP: erro de sintaxe, inesperado '<' em /var/www/monfichier.php3(60): eval () 'd code on line 1 

Solução

  • Isto é provavelmente devido à presença de tags PHP em torno da string que precisa ser avaliada:

  • Conforme declarado na documentação do PHP, as tags de abertura do PHP não devem estar presentes para avaliar uma string. Para corrigir o problema, basta excluir a tag de abertura da string.
  • Nota: você ainda pode usar as tags de fechamento do PHP para sair do modo PHP

=====

Artigo Anterior Próximo Artigo

Principais Dicas